I am writing to express my concern and opposition to the In-&-Out (I&O) fast food location located near the Costco at Lost Rapids and Ten Mile roads. My concerns are as follows:  I&O has requested to be open until 2 AM. This will be disruptive to nearby homeowners with constant traffic, noise associated with the traffic and lights that will shine and disturb residents far into the night.  Costco will again petition the city to allow semitruck deliveries to Costco along Tree Farm and Lost Rapids past the current 10 PM cutoff.  ‘Customer flow’ information that I&O provided is flawed. It compares our neighborhood area with ten California-based locations, none of which is located in residential or semi-residential areas.  The ‘traffic study’ that I&O paid for and provided is similarly flawed. It looks only at the Ten Mile/Lost Rapids intersection on three days in early December. It does not consider the various choke points with the accident-prone entrance north of the intersection, does not consider the Chinden/Lost Rapids traffic, and does not include the weekly event traffic for eight months out of the year for Hero’s Park or the 60-plus vehicles for four days a week parked at Keith Bird Park and along Lost Rapids. It does not consider the Adero Park subdivision that will be presented in May that will add 270 homes between Bainbridge & Walmart. My opposition is only focused on this specific location; sites less than a mile away in any direction are preferable to this one and removes the restaurant from almost every neighborhood concern. The city can and should deny the requested location, order a city sponsored traffic analysis, or approve the request with conditions to restrict lights and noise infiltration to mitigate the adverse effects on the community.
